Obsah:
Video: Čo je lambda autorizátor?
2024 Autor: Lynn Donovan | [email protected]. Naposledy zmenené: 2023-12-15 23:52
A Lambda autorizátor (predtým známy ako zvyk splnomocnenca ) je funkcia brány API, ktorá využíva a lambda funkcia na riadenie prístupu k vášmu API. Na základe tokenov Lambda autorizátor (nazývaný aj TOKEN splnomocnenca ) dostane identitu volajúceho v tokene nosiča, ako je napríklad webový token JSON (JWT) alebo token OAuth.
Vzhľadom na to, ako otestujem autorizáciu brány API?
Na ŽIADOSŤ splnomocnenca , zadajte platné parametre požiadavky zodpovedajúce zadaným zdrojom identity a potom vyberte Test . Okrem použitia Brána API konzolu, môžete použiť AWS CLI alebo an AWS SDK pre Brána API do test vyvolanie an splnomocnenca . Ak to chcete urobiť pomocou AWS CLI, pozri test -vzývať- splnomocnenca.
čo je brána API? An API brána je jadrom an API manažérske riešenie. Pôsobí ako jediný vstup do systému umožňujúceho viacero API alebo mikroslužby, aby pôsobili súdržne a poskytovali používateľovi jednotný zážitok. Najdôležitejšou úlohou je API brána hrá zaisťuje spoľahlivé spracovanie každého API hovor.
Čo je potom token na doručiteľa?
Žetóny na doručiteľa sú prevládajúcim typom prístupu žetón používané s OAuth 2.0. A Token na doručiteľa je nepriehľadný reťazec, ktorý nemá žiadny význam pre klientov, ktorí ho používajú. Niektoré servery budú problém žetóny ktoré sú krátkym reťazcom hexadecimálnych znakov, zatiaľ čo iné môžu používať štruktúrované žetóny ako je JSON Web Tokeny.
Ako skontrolujete Lambdu na Amazone?
Kroky na testovanie funkcie Lambda
- Vytvorte projekt AWS Lambda Java. ?
- Vytvorte funkciu AWS Lambda. Musíte implementovať funkciu Lambda handleRequest v triede LambdaFunctionHandler.
- Jednotkový test funkcie AWS Lambda.
- Nahrajte a spustite funkciu AWS Lambda.
- Otestujte funkciu Lambda vlastnej udalosti.
Odporúča:
Čo je funkcia Lambda step?
S funkciami AWS Step a AWS Lambda AWS Lambda je výpočtová služba, ktorá vám umožňuje spúšťať kód bez poskytovania alebo správy serverov. Step Functions je služba orchestrácie bez servera, ktorá vám umožňuje jednoducho koordinovať viacero funkcií Lambda do flexibilných pracovných postupov, ktoré sa dajú ľahko ladiť a ľahko meniť
Beží Lambda na ec2?
Spúšťanie aplikácií na inštanciách EC2 je dobrým riešením, keď aplikácie musia byť spustené pravidelne počas celého dňa. lambda. Funkcia Lambda je vždy k dispozícii, ale nie je spustená stále. Štandardne je funkcia Lambda neaktívna
Môže Lambda poll SQS?
Funkciu AWS Lambda môžete použiť na spracovanie správ vo fronte služby Amazon Simple Queue Service (Amazon SQS). Lambda vyzve frontu a vyvolá vašu funkciu synchrónne s udalosťou, ktorá obsahuje správy vo fronte. Lambda číta správy v dávkach a vyvoláva vašu funkciu raz pre každú dávku
Čo je Lambda edge v AWS?
Lambda@Edge je funkcia Amazon CloudFront, ktorá vám umožňuje spúšťať kód bližšie k používateľom vašej aplikácie, čo zlepšuje výkon a znižuje latenciu. Lambda@Edge spúšťa váš kód v reakcii na udalosti generované sieťou na doručovanie obsahu Amazon CloudFront (CDN)
Ako si stiahnem AWS Lambda?
Prejdite na nastavenia funkcie lambda a vpravo hore budete mať tlačidlo s názvom „Akcie“. V rozbaľovacej ponuke vyberte „exportovať“a vo vyskakovacom okne kliknite na „Stiahnuť balík nasadenia“a funkcia sa stiahne do a. zip súbor